Sweet Simmered Carp
A must-have dish for celebratory occasions in Yonezawa
About Sweet Simmered Carp
Sweet Simmered Carp (鯉のうま煮, Koi no Umani) is a signature dish of Yonezawa, representing its traditional carp cuisine.
The carp is sliced into rounds and simmered with sugar, soy sauce, and sake, creating a flavorful and tender dish. The slow cooking process softens the bones so much that they can be eaten, and any freshwater fish smell is completely removed, making it easy to enjoy. Loved by many locals, it’s a true favorite.
In Yamagata Prefecture, this delicacy is often served during festive events such as New Year’s, Obon, and weddings, as a symbol of celebration.
